Domaine de Sengresse is situated just 500 yards from the River Adour in the heart of the Landes countryside. An area known for its gastronomy, forests, rivers and miles of sand dunes and surf.
Visit unspoilt villages with their little cafĂ©s, markets and evening farmersâ markets where you can sample local produce; absorb the atmosphere and watch traditional dancing.
Village fĂȘtes begin in May and continue through until the autumn. The fĂȘtes include: dancing, music, events for children, pĂ©tanque, fishing competitions, concerts and the famous Course Landaise in the local arena. In Mugron the town band leads children carrying lanterns through the streets on the opening night of the FĂȘte.
The area is famed for its Course Landaise. All villages and towns have their own arenas. This is not to be confused with bull fighting but is a dangerous sport for young men and, occasionally, women who perform amazing acrobatics around and over some very ferocious looking cows! Not to be missed!
Sengresse is 2kms from a Michelin Green route which trails from Mugron to Montaut and on to St Sever, where brass cockle shells demark the pilgrim route of Santiago de Compostela. Return via the chateaux at Amou and Gaujacq or the ancient bastide of Montfort en Chalosse. Dax is 35 minutes away - known for its hot springs and rugby.

Nearest airports are Biarritz and Pau (1hr) Bordeaux (1œ hrs) and Toulouse (3œ hrs). We are half an hour from the city of Dax with its direct train connections to Paris. Just 1œ hours from Spain with flights from Bilbao to London Heathrow and its internal airport at Saint Sebastian with connections to Madrid. Brittany Ferries with routes to the UK from Santander and Bilbao.
